How To Get a Tin Number In Uganda

Application for a TIN is done online via URA’s website www.ura.go.ug.

Before application, an individual needs the following identifications; a National ID, a driver’s license, and a passport.

Visit the URA website and then go to e-services, Click instant TIN, Fill in the required fields and click submit.

How long does it take to get an individual TIN number in Uganda?

​​​​​​​Taxpayer Identification Number (TIN)

URA will send an Auto notification of the receipt of your application upon submission.

For applications without VAT, we aim to notify you of your TIN or a decision on your registration application within 2 working days of receiving all the necessary information.

What do I need to register for TIN?

To obtain a Taxpayer Identification Number (TIN) as an Individual include: Duly completed TIN Application Form.

Form of identification – National Driver’s License, International Passport, National Identity Card, Official (Staff) ID card, Certified copy of your full birth certificate.

Utility bill.
